Before we look at solar panel wiring, let's define some key electrical terms you need to know: Voltage shows the difference in electric charge between two points in a circuit.
Wiring: To connect solar panels, a wiring system is used. There are two types of wiring systems commonly used: series wiring and parallel wiring. In series wiring, the positive terminal of one solar panel is connected to the negative terminal of the next panel. This allows the generated voltage to add up, resulting in a higher voltage output.
